The First Steps – Site Feasibility

When subdividing your land with our NZ professionals, we will provide you with detailed reports and quotes on possible development options for your section. We’re happy to talk to you about your project with an initial, no-obligation consultation and offer a professional land development service with expert knowledge of council district plans and by-laws.

With experience facilitating land development and implementing subdivisions in Wellington, we can manage your whole project, from development and planning right through to building and construction. 

Our subdivision services include:

  • Development plans for the overall layout

  • Resource consent preparation

  • Designing and collaborating earthworks for roading and services

  • Overseeing legal boundary surveys where required

Unrivalled Expertise

Using only the best engineers, surveyors and contractors in the industry who are up-to-date with best practice techniques and solutions, we accurately assess the adequacy of individual sites for planned development — however big or small. 

Our initial assessment involves site inspection, inspecting council drainage records, reviewing district plan rules, searching for title certificates, and providing advice on the most sustainable form of subdivision for your property.

Why Subdivide Your Wellington Land?

There are many reasons why our clients choose to subdivide their sections. Some financial, some convenience. Whatever the reason, subdividing land poses many advantages to NZ property owners, including:

  • Subdividing your NZ property can help attract more buyers, especially those seeking smaller homes or people looking to break into the property market.

  • Divided sections are often worth more than undivided ones, helping land owners increase their profits faster.

  • Property owners can identify different uses for their land, dividing it into smaller sections based on what is profitable at the time, whether that’s for housing or business purposes.

  • Owning several smaller properties means you can rent them out to different people and earn money from each one. Additionally, if one tenant leaves, you'll still have income from other tenants, making your earnings more stable.

  • Selling parts of a subdivided property can give you quick cash to use for other investments or expenses. Further, regular rental income from multiple tenants helps ensure you have steady money coming in each month.
